- [ ] Step 7: Archive cold storage buckets (Glacierline tier). Confirm both ceremony witnesses are present, verify bucket manifests match the Oxbow ledger, then seal the archive key shares. Plugin authors may observe but not handle shares. Once sealed, the archive index itself is encrypted and can only be reopened with the passphrase below.

vault phrase of badup-hahig = tamael-aldael-kelmir-istael-fenok-istwyn-tamius-jorath-oliion

**Vendor note: Inkmill markdown pipeline**

Rendering for Parchway docs is outsourced to Inkmill under an annual contract, renewing each March. They handle sanitization and PDF export; we own the upload queue. SLA: 4-hour response on rendering failures. Escalate only after two failed retries. Their support desk is reachable at the address below.

billing contact of hahaf-baguf = zorael.tammir.jorius@sivrelhq.internal

Ticket: AGR-2291 — Config drift on Harrowlink gateway

The Harrowlink farm-equipment telemetry gateway in the west cluster has drifted from baseline. Plugin authors: your telemetry parsers may see altered batch sizes and retry windows until this is reconciled. Do not hardcode around it. For reference, the current (drifted) values observed on the node are:

deployment values, yadug-bawif:
[framir]
team = pelox
access_code = ac_a38ab2
owner = tamion.julael
host = framir.tolvaqlabs.test
port = 11211
peer = tammir.zemvargrid.local
salt = 2215ef03
pin = 1541

Hi Tomas — quick handover on the Wrenvale wiki permissions work. Role-based access is live: Editors can publish, Contributors need review, and the legacy 'superuser' flag is gone. New folks sometimes get stuck with default read-only, so check group sync first. The access-control settings the wiki service currently runs with are below.

config for bagep-kageg:
ULADOR_LOG_LEVEL=warn
ULADOR_METRICS_HOST=metrics.ulador.tolvaqcorp.corp
ULADOR_POOL_SIZE=32

Subject: Snapshot test pass for Lanternwick UI kit

Hi reviewer — all snapshot tests for the Lanternwick component library are green after the button-radius change. I regenerated baselines only for the three affected cards and left everything else untouched; please confirm the diffs look intentional. The trace token for the snapshot run is below.

build token for yajof-bajof: htk31_506ff1188f74596b5bb2eec94edc43c